Cryopreserved PBMCs were thawed and used simultaneously in the same assay to reduce assay-to-assay variation. IFN-γ ELISPOT assays were performed in triplicate with 1 × 106 cells per well with either medium or 15 μg/ml A. marginale Florida strain homogenate for 48 h at 37°C. Results are presented as the mean numbers of SFCs. p.i., postinfection. For values of ≥600 SFCs (too numerous to count), a statistical comparison was not performed.
